Chrysanthemum Flowers No. 3 is a vibrant, contemporary reimagining of the classic floral still life. This piece leans into a bold, monochromatic exploration of neon corals and soft roses, utilizing a glowing, spray-painted aesthetic that feels both ethereal and modern.
The Blooms: The chrysanthemum heads are rendered with intricate, hand-drawn linework, capturing the "regular incurve" density of the petals. The overlapping, circular forms create a sense of vibrating energy against the saturated pink background.
The Vessel: Below, a silhouetted, classical urn anchors the arrangement. The soft, diffused edges of the vessel suggest a stencil or spray-paint technique, providing a misty, atmospheric contrast to the sharp line-work of the flowers.
The Texture: Subtle splatters and tonal gradients throughout the piece give it a tactile, street-art-meets-fine-art sensibility.
This piece bridges the gap between traditional botanical study and modern pop art. Its high-energy palette and graphic execution make it a standout focal point for interiors that embrace maximalism, Mid-century Modern accents, or contemporary eclectic styles.

Susan Havens is a New Orleans–based artist who holds a Bachelor of Fine Arts from the School of the Art Institute of Chicago. With over 27 years of experience as a graphic designer, art director, and creative director, her work reflects a refined understanding of composition, color, and visual storytelling.
Her artwork is held in private collections and has been placed in residences, private clubs, and hospitality environments by interior designers, as well as featured at the Ogden Museum of Southern Art in New Orleans.
